![Page 1: Light Scaering by Small Parcles - University of Florida Scattering... · Light scaering by Small Parcles 2 ... Matlab, Fortran Mie solution by a homogeneous ... The scattering of](https://reader031.vdocuments.mx/reader031/viewer/2022022011/5b0d17d97f8b9a02508d28bd/html5/thumbnails/1.jpg)
LightSca*eringbySmallPar3cles
MinZhongApr.2nd.2010
![Page 2: Light Scaering by Small Parcles - University of Florida Scattering... · Light scaering by Small Parcles 2 ... Matlab, Fortran Mie solution by a homogeneous ... The scattering of](https://reader031.vdocuments.mx/reader031/viewer/2022022011/5b0d17d97f8b9a02508d28bd/html5/thumbnails/2.jpg)
Outline
• Backgroundintroduc3on• Theory• Applica3on• Reference
PHY4422 2Lightsca*eringbySmallPar3cles
Haveyouseenanylightscatteringphenomenadaily?
Source:myskymom.com
![Page 3: Light Scaering by Small Parcles - University of Florida Scattering... · Light scaering by Small Parcles 2 ... Matlab, Fortran Mie solution by a homogeneous ... The scattering of](https://reader031.vdocuments.mx/reader031/viewer/2022022011/5b0d17d97f8b9a02508d28bd/html5/thumbnails/3.jpg)
AerosolandClimateChange
• Aerosol:suspendedpar3clesinatmosphere
• Size:typicalrange0.01~100um• Source:nature(90%)andhumanac3vi3es(10%)
PHY4422 Lightsca*eringwithPar3cles 3
Source:nasa.org
Introduc3on
![Page 4: Light Scaering by Small Parcles - University of Florida Scattering... · Light scaering by Small Parcles 2 ... Matlab, Fortran Mie solution by a homogeneous ... The scattering of](https://reader031.vdocuments.mx/reader031/viewer/2022022011/5b0d17d97f8b9a02508d28bd/html5/thumbnails/4.jpg)
AerosolandClimateChange
PHY4422 Lightsca*eringwithPar3cles 4
Source:sciencedaily.com
• Aerosolcanabsorborsca*ersunlight,warmingeffectandcoolingeffect
• Theuncertaintyofaerosolmakesthetotales3matesolarge
• Aerosolisthekeytoclimatechange
Introduc3on
![Page 5: Light Scaering by Small Parcles - University of Florida Scattering... · Light scaering by Small Parcles 2 ... Matlab, Fortran Mie solution by a homogeneous ... The scattering of](https://reader031.vdocuments.mx/reader031/viewer/2022022011/5b0d17d97f8b9a02508d28bd/html5/thumbnails/5.jpg)
Interac3onbetweenlightandpar3cle
PHY4422 Lightsca*eringwithPar3cles 5
• Elas&csca(eringThewavelengthofthesca*eringisthesameasthatoftheincidentlight
• Inelas&csca(eringTheemi*edlighthasawavelengthdifferentfromthatoftheincidentlight
Reflec3onλ0
Incidentlightλ0
RamanλR
FluorescenceλF
Refrac3onλ0
Thermalemissionλj
Par3cle
Sca*eringλ0
Absorp3on
Fortheinterac3onofsolarradia3onwithatmosphericaerosols,elas3clightsca*eringistheprocessofinterest.
Introduc3on
![Page 6: Light Scaering by Small Parcles - University of Florida Scattering... · Light scaering by Small Parcles 2 ... Matlab, Fortran Mie solution by a homogeneous ... The scattering of](https://reader031.vdocuments.mx/reader031/viewer/2022022011/5b0d17d97f8b9a02508d28bd/html5/thumbnails/6.jpg)
PHY4422 Lightsca*eringwithPar3cles 6
Elas3cLightSca*ering
• RayleighSca*ering– Spherical,small,non‐absorbing,.
• MieSca*ering– Spherical,absorbing/non‐absorbing,nosizebound.
LordRayleigh GustavMieSource:Nobelprize.org
Introduc3on
![Page 7: Light Scaering by Small Parcles - University of Florida Scattering... · Light scaering by Small Parcles 2 ... Matlab, Fortran Mie solution by a homogeneous ... The scattering of](https://reader031.vdocuments.mx/reader031/viewer/2022022011/5b0d17d97f8b9a02508d28bd/html5/thumbnails/7.jpg)
LightSca*ering
PHY4422 Lightsca*eringwithPar3cles 7
• Redirec3onofEMwavewhenencountersanobstacleornon‐homogeneity(Sca*eringAerosol).
• ItisNOTasimplebounceofPhoton.Hahn,D.W.etal
Introduc3on
![Page 8: Light Scaering by Small Parcles - University of Florida Scattering... · Light scaering by Small Parcles 2 ... Matlab, Fortran Mie solution by a homogeneous ... The scattering of](https://reader031.vdocuments.mx/reader031/viewer/2022022011/5b0d17d97f8b9a02508d28bd/html5/thumbnails/8.jpg)
LightSca*ering
PHY4422 Lightsca*eringwithPar3cles 8
Threeparametersthatgovernthesca*ering:
1.Wavelengthλofincidentlight2.Sizeofthepar3cle,sizeparameter
3.thepar3cleop3calpropertyrela3vetothesurroundingmedium,refrac0veindex
CriteriaforRayleighRegimex<<1,or|m|x<<1
Introduc3on
![Page 9: Light Scaering by Small Parcles - University of Florida Scattering... · Light scaering by Small Parcles 2 ... Matlab, Fortran Mie solution by a homogeneous ... The scattering of](https://reader031.vdocuments.mx/reader031/viewer/2022022011/5b0d17d97f8b9a02508d28bd/html5/thumbnails/9.jpg)
RayleighTheory
PHY4422 Lightsca*eringwithPar3cles 9
Theory
Assump&on:par3cleissmallcomparedtothewavelengthsothattheelectricfieldinsidethepar3cleduetoEMwaveisuniform.
Source:wikimedia
Auniformelectricfiledinsidethepar3cle
Hi
Ei
CoordinategeometryforRayleighandMiesca*ering,
Source:ipac.caltech.edu
Rayleightheorydescribesthesca*eringofelectromagne3cradia3onbysmallsphericalpar3clesbasedonthedipolemoment �
![Page 10: Light Scaering by Small Parcles - University of Florida Scattering... · Light scaering by Small Parcles 2 ... Matlab, Fortran Mie solution by a homogeneous ... The scattering of](https://reader031.vdocuments.mx/reader031/viewer/2022022011/5b0d17d97f8b9a02508d28bd/html5/thumbnails/10.jpg)
PHY4422 Lightsca*eringwithPar3cles 10
RayleighTheory
p:dipolemomenta:par3cleradiusE0:incidentelectricfieldε:electricconstant
Source:MKerker
Incidentoscilla3onelectricfiled:inducedoscilla3ondipolemoment
Accelera3ngchargescanemitradiatetheoscilla3ondipoleswillradiateatthesamefrequencyastheappliedfieldinallthedirec3on
Bluesky
Theory
![Page 11: Light Scaering by Small Parcles - University of Florida Scattering... · Light scaering by Small Parcles 2 ... Matlab, Fortran Mie solution by a homogeneous ... The scattering of](https://reader031.vdocuments.mx/reader031/viewer/2022022011/5b0d17d97f8b9a02508d28bd/html5/thumbnails/11.jpg)
Bluesky&RedSunsets
PHY4422 Lightsca*eringwithPar3cles 11
• Day3meskylooksblueonaclearday• Theskylooksredatsunriseandsunset
Bluelightissca*eredmoreefficientlythanred
Why?
h*p://www.forbrf.lth.se/
Applica3on
![Page 12: Light Scaering by Small Parcles - University of Florida Scattering... · Light scaering by Small Parcles 2 ... Matlab, Fortran Mie solution by a homogeneous ... The scattering of](https://reader031.vdocuments.mx/reader031/viewer/2022022011/5b0d17d97f8b9a02508d28bd/html5/thumbnails/12.jpg)
Miesca*ering�
PHY4422 Lightsca*eringwithPar3cles 12
Mietheorydescribesthesca*eringandabsorp3onofelectromagne3cradia3onbysphericalpar3clesthroughsolvingtheMaxwellequa3ons �
KeyAssump*ons �
i)Par3cleisasphere;ii)Par3cleishomogeneous(thereforeitischaracterizedbyasinglerefrac&veindexm=n‐ikatagivenwavelength);�
![Page 13: Light Scaering by Small Parcles - University of Florida Scattering... · Light scaering by Small Parcles 2 ... Matlab, Fortran Mie solution by a homogeneous ... The scattering of](https://reader031.vdocuments.mx/reader031/viewer/2022022011/5b0d17d97f8b9a02508d28bd/html5/thumbnails/13.jpg)
Solu3onofMiesca*ering
PHY4422 Lightsca*eringwithPar3cles 13
Intensi3esofsca*eringradia3on Crosssec3ons
Fortunately,therearesomepeoplewhoenjoysolvingtheseequa3onsandsepngupcomputerprogramstocalculatetheresults.
OverviewofMiesca(eringsolu&onforspheres:
• BeginwithMaxwell’sequa3ons• Deriveawaveequa3oninsphericalpolarcoordinates
• Provideboundarycondi3onsatsurfaceofasphere
• Solvethepar3aldifferen3alwaveequa3onfordependenceonr,θ, φ.
![Page 14: Light Scaering by Small Parcles - University of Florida Scattering... · Light scaering by Small Parcles 2 ... Matlab, Fortran Mie solution by a homogeneous ... The scattering of](https://reader031.vdocuments.mx/reader031/viewer/2022022011/5b0d17d97f8b9a02508d28bd/html5/thumbnails/14.jpg)
MieSca*eringCode
PHY4422 Lightsca*eringwithPar3cles 14
Year Name Authors Language Short description
1983 BHMIE Craig F. Bohren Matlab, Fortran Mie solution by a homogeneous
sphere
2002 MiePlot Philip Laven VB Solution for a number of wavelength
2003 Mie single Gareth Thomas IDL Solution for both single and populations of particle with
log-normal PSD
CodeforMiesca(eringbyasinglesphere
Year Name Authors Language Short description
1993 IFCS Thomas Kaiser Fortran Compute the scattered filed of sphere with 1 to 2 coatings
2004 M.Jonasz Fortran Compute parameters of single coated sphere
2003 L. Liu C Light scattering by a coated sphere
Codesforelectromagne&csca(eringbyalayeredsphere
Source:Wikipedia.org
![Page 15: Light Scaering by Small Parcles - University of Florida Scattering... · Light scaering by Small Parcles 2 ... Matlab, Fortran Mie solution by a homogeneous ... The scattering of](https://reader031.vdocuments.mx/reader031/viewer/2022022011/5b0d17d97f8b9a02508d28bd/html5/thumbnails/15.jpg)
Calculateop3calparameters
PHY4422 Lightsca*eringwithPar3cles 15
Par3clesizeRefrac3veindex,m(λ)
Forasinglesphericalpar3cle,theMietheorygivestheex3nc3on,sca*eringandabsorp3oncross‐sec3ons,thesca*eringamplitudesandphasematrix.
Mietheory
Sca*eringcrosssec3on,σsAbsorp3oncrosssec3on,σaEx3nc3oncrosssec3on,σe
(asafunc3onofapar3clesizeandwavelength)
Sca*eringcoefficient,σsAbsorp3oncoefficient,σaEx3nc3oncoefficient,σe
(asafunc3onofapar3clesizeandwavelength)
Mietheory
![Page 16: Light Scaering by Small Parcles - University of Florida Scattering... · Light scaering by Small Parcles 2 ... Matlab, Fortran Mie solution by a homogeneous ... The scattering of](https://reader031.vdocuments.mx/reader031/viewer/2022022011/5b0d17d97f8b9a02508d28bd/html5/thumbnails/16.jpg)
Miesca*ering�
PHY4422 Lightsca*eringwithPar3cles 16
Ex3nc3onefficiencyvssizeparameter(noabsorp3on):1)SmallinRayleighlimitQextx∝x4
2)LargestQextwhenpar3cleandwavelengthhavesimilarsize.3)Qext2ingeometriclimit(x∞).4)Oscilla3onsfrominterferenceoftransmi*edanddiffractedwaves.5)Periodinxofinterferenceoscilla3onsdependsontherefrac3veindex.Absorp3onreducesinterferenceoscilla3onsandkillsripplestructure.
SomehighlightsofMiesca(eringresults:�
![Page 17: Light Scaering by Small Parcles - University of Florida Scattering... · Light scaering by Small Parcles 2 ... Matlab, Fortran Mie solution by a homogeneous ... The scattering of](https://reader031.vdocuments.mx/reader031/viewer/2022022011/5b0d17d97f8b9a02508d28bd/html5/thumbnails/17.jpg)
ApplyMieSca*eringtoaerosolstudy�
PHY4422 Lightsca*eringwithPar3cles 17
UV/VisLight
FilterFilter
Detector
UV‐lamp
GC‐FID
SMPS
TempRH
Par3cles
2)UV/Visspectrometer
1)TeflonChamber
3)Nephelometer
1.Chamberexperimentpar3clesize,concentra3on2.UV/Visabsorp3oncoefficient,3.Nephelometerex3c3oncoefficient,3wavelength4.InputtheabovedataintoMiesca*eringcodeandfindouttherefrac3veindex(m)5.Comparethecomputed(m)tothemeasuredmmcanbemeasuredbytheelectronenergy‐lossspectroscopyusingTEMequippedwithaGatanTriDiemspectrometer(DuncanT.L.Alexander,etal.Science321,833,2008)
Applica3on
![Page 18: Light Scaering by Small Parcles - University of Florida Scattering... · Light scaering by Small Parcles 2 ... Matlab, Fortran Mie solution by a homogeneous ... The scattering of](https://reader031.vdocuments.mx/reader031/viewer/2022022011/5b0d17d97f8b9a02508d28bd/html5/thumbnails/18.jpg)
References
PHY4422 Lightsca*eringwithPar3cles 18
1. M. Kerker. The scattering of light and other electromagnetic radiation. Academic, New York. 1969. 2. H.C. van de Hulst. Light scattering by small particles. John Wiley & Sons, New York, 1957. 3. C.F. Bohren and D.R. Huffman. Absorption and scattering of light by small particles. John Wiley & Sons, New York, 1983. 4. http://plaza.ufl.edu/dwhahn/Diagnostic%20Tutorials.html 5.Willian C. Hinds. Aerosol Technology, John Wiley & Sons, New York, 1998. 6. John H. Seinfeld and Spyros N. Pandis. Atmospheric Chemistry and Physics. John Wiley & Sons, New York, 1997. 7. Benjamin Chu, Laser light scattering, Academic, New York, 1974.
![Page 19: Light Scaering by Small Parcles - University of Florida Scattering... · Light scaering by Small Parcles 2 ... Matlab, Fortran Mie solution by a homogeneous ... The scattering of](https://reader031.vdocuments.mx/reader031/viewer/2022022011/5b0d17d97f8b9a02508d28bd/html5/thumbnails/19.jpg)
Thankyou!
PHY4422 Lightsca*eringwithPar3cles 19
![Page 20: Light Scaering by Small Parcles - University of Florida Scattering... · Light scaering by Small Parcles 2 ... Matlab, Fortran Mie solution by a homogeneous ... The scattering of](https://reader031.vdocuments.mx/reader031/viewer/2022022011/5b0d17d97f8b9a02508d28bd/html5/thumbnails/20.jpg)
Whatcanthecodedo
PHY4422 Lightsca*eringwithPar3cles 20
Interac&veMieSca(eringCalculatorath*p://omlc.ogi.edu/calc/mie_calc.html